Can a smartwatch help rural seniors age better? taiwan launches landmark study

NCT ID NCT07232667

First seen Nov 18, 2025 · Last updated Jun 18, 2026 · Updated 29 times

Summary

This study aims to help older adults in rural Taiwan live healthier lives by using wearable devices and a mobile app to track activity, sleep, and other health measures. Researchers will work with 140 participants to see if this technology can improve health literacy and identify early signs of cognitive or physical decline. The goal is to build a digital database that can predict and prevent age-related health problems.
